Management EfficiencyAbstract: The study examines the bank capital requirement and its impact on bank performance in context of Nepalese Commercial banks. The return on equity and net interest margin is selected as dependent variables whereas capital adequacy ratio, liquidity, management efficiency, lending and deposit selected as independent variables. The data were collected from the banking and financial statistics and supervision report published by Nepal Rastra Bank and annual report of selected commercial banks. The multiple regression models, correlation, descriptive statistics is used for the analysis purpose of this study. The multiple regression models was estimated to test impact of deposit, lending, CAR, liquidity ratio, efficiency ratio on ROE and NIM of Nepalese commercial banks.
The study consists of joint venture bank, private owned bank and government owned bank with study period from 2006/07 to 2015/16. The result of this study shows that there is significant relationship between CAR and NIM. But the study found that there is no significant relationship between CAR and ROE. Net profit ratioAbstract: The study examines the banking failure and its impact on the shareholders in context of Nepalese commercial banks. The return on equity is selected as dependent variable whereas non-performing assets, capital adequacy ratio, earnings per share and the net profit ratio selected as independent variables. The data were collected from the banking and financial statistics and supervision report published by Nepal Rastra Bank and annual report of selected commercial banks. The multiple regression model, correlation, descriptive statistics is used for the analysis purpose of this study. The multiple regression model was estimated to test impact of NPA, CAR, EPS, NPR on ROE of Nepalese commercial banks.
The study consists of 10 commercial banks of Nepal with study period from 2005/06 to 2014/15. The result of this study shows that negative significant relationship between NPA and ROE, NPR and ROE whereas positive significant relationship between CAR and ROE. But study found that no significant relationship between EPS and ROE. Among the variables, NPA is found to be the most important determining variable that affect the return om equity as well as CAR, NPR, and EPS are also determining factors

Return on assetsAbstract: Nepal has witnessed substantial quantitative growth in the banking sector after the regulatory reforms by Nepal Rastra bank (NRB). The substantial increases in the number of banks have created intense competition among them. This has resulted sharp upward trend in the number of financially troubled banks. The study examined level of cost efficiency of 18 “A” class commercial banks during the period of 2009 to 2015 by using descriptive, correlation as well as regression analysis. The overall result indicates that non-performing loans, capital adequacy ratio, risk weighted assets and loan loss provision has positive and significant impact on cost of the banks which means that increase in these variables leads to increase in cost and vice versa. These factors have negative relationship with cost efficiency. Return on assets shows negative relationship with cost efficiency which shows that increase in ROA leads to decrease in cost and promotes cost efficiency in commercial banks of Nepal. advertisementAbstract: Soft drink has been an important medium of refreshment. The manufacturers of the drinks caught the attention of people through attractive advertisement. Leading companies have started releasing drinks with numerous name brands in Nepalese market. This study aims at analyzing whether the factors, such as taste, price, packaging, and celebrity, affect the brand preference of soft drink. In an attempt to get the result, the hypothesis is developed to identify weather there is a significant relationship between the above mentioned advertised attributes which are taken as the independent variables, and brand preference of soft drink, which is taken as the dependent variable. This study focuses on analyzing the consumer’s brand preferences for Aerated/ Carbonated drinks focusing on Coca Cola, Fanta, Sprite, Pepsi, Slice and Mountain Dew. A structured questionnaire was used to collect data from 84 respondents who were of both genders; male and female through convenience sampling.
The results show that taste and price of the soft drink brand influences the respondents to make brand preferences but not by packaging and celebrity endorsements. Similarly, the respondents of different occupation get influenced by taste and price but do not get influenced by packaging and celebrity. The study also revealed that Television is the most effective media used for advertising the brand. In view of this, the marketing managers of soft drink companies are suggested to give more attention to Television as a medium of advertisement because of its versatile feature and better geographic coverage. They can employ integrated advertising of their products and allocate more budgets for Television advertisements due to its great impact in influencing consumer choice. Likewise, after television outdoor media is also given preference. Therefore looking at the current scenario, advertisement in social media such as YouTube, Facebook can also create a lot of influence amongst people of all age groups.
